Understanding the Wires
Typically, a twist throttle has three wires:
- Positive (VCC or +5V): Provides power to the throttle.
- Ground (GND): The reference point for the electrical circuit.
- Signal Wire: Sends the voltage signal to the controller, indicating the desired speed.
Step-by-Step Wiring Guide
Here’s a general guide to connecting your twist throttle. Always refer to your specific vehicle or kit's wiring diagram, as color codes and configurations can vary.
- Identify the Wires: Use a multimeter to identify the positive, ground, and signal wires on both the throttle and the controller.
- Connect the Positive Wire: Connect the positive wire from the throttle to the positive wire on the controller. This is usually red.
- Connect the Ground Wire: Connect the ground wire from the throttle to the ground wire on the controller. This is usually black.
- Connect the Signal Wire: Connect the signal wire from the throttle to the signal wire on the controller. This is often white, green, or blue.
- Secure the Connections: Use heat shrink tubing or electrical tape to insulate and protect the connections.
Common Wiring Diagrams
While specific diagrams vary, here are a few common configurations:
- 3-Wire Throttle: This is the most common setup, with positive, ground, and signal wires.
- 5-Wire Throttle: These may include additional wires for features like a battery indicator or switch.
Troubleshooting Tips
- Throttle Not Responding: Check all connections and ensure the wires are securely connected.
- Erratic Acceleration: Inspect the signal wire for damage or loose connections.
- System Not Powering On: Verify the positive and ground connections.
